Output 32a665f1d05789de3e6444a5f917e7ddf6a20ea25d56845a412ca3630a014f9d:0

value
652900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53cbfe7a02c3d0a64ca3a54e9ec042751ae2b859 OP_EQUALVERIFY OP_CHECKSIG
address
18e5TgGFmJ2zKYsHnvAogFMQ4PkeNLQzhU
transaction
32a665f1d05789de3e6444a5f917e7ddf6a20ea25d56845a412ca3630a014f9d
spent
true